Here’s a little nugget for you,

I have been playing around with Apps lately after acquiring some lovely gadgetry and I came across Zeebox. I have seen the TV adverts with the big man as the TV and the little man as Zeebox and that it is designed to let you interact with your favourite tv shows via social media.

Well what I didn’t expect was that this app would in fact bump up my followers on twitter quite considerably, so starting to receive up to around 20 new followers a week just from simply making comments on my favourite TV shows.

Well according to some this has been around since 2006 and has had a steady following until early last year when interest (or Pinterest) for the site started to explode and by early this year Pinterest was looking down the barrel of over 10 million unique visitors in US.
